Verstappen quickest in opening session

Ahead of today's opening session at Mexico City - as F1 returns following a 23 year hiatus, the air temperature is 18 degrees C, whilst the track temperature is 21 degrees. Whilst the weather has been perfect up to now, a shower has left parts of the track damp. We are, of course, expecting heavy rain tomorrow. Tyre options are the same as Austin - and no, we dot mean full wets and Inters - rather medium and soft. Indeed, the session is declared wet. There are two DRS zones - though one detection point - the first activation point is on the pit straight and the second on the run between Turns 3 and 4.
